Built in 1912 and designed by renowned Parisian architects Edward and George Blum, 780 West End Avenue is a striking Art Nouveau high-rise. This 13-story masterpiece features an elegant white-brick fa ade, a granite base, and intricate terracotta detailing, standing as a timeless landmark at the corner of 98th Street and West End Avenue.
